I guess I should finally get around to putting something here. I am surprised that it has received so much attention recently.
This video was created for the AARP U@50 video contest and placed second
It is based on the Argentinian Political Advertisement “The Truth” by RECREAR
Thanks to joezandstra for posting it as a video response. If you would like more info about the video you can find it here
